Документы azure, описывающие интеграцию управления API с шлюзом приложений в VNet (https://docs.microsoft.com/en-us/azure/api-management/api-management-howto-integrate-internal-vnet-appgateway), состоят из довольно сложных, не интуитивно понятных шагов.
Существует ли какой-либо интуитивно понятный способ с помощью портала Azure интегрировать 2 вышеупомянутых компонента? Эта же проблема также размещена в документации для обратной связи. https://feedback.azure.com/forums/248703-api-management/suggestions/39301564-documentation-fully-featured-application-gateway
Я настроил шлюз приложения следующим образом с настройками: Настройки прослушивателя:
Настройки внутреннего пула:
IP-адрес является частным IP-адресом управления API в том же Vnet, что и шлюз приложения
Настройки HTTP:
- На сайте управления API я настроил API для отправки ложного ответа и настроил его как обычный запрос GET к пути "/". Нужно ли настраивать что-либо еще на стороне управления API?
- Я делаю это для целей тестирования, поэтому я сохранил протокол как HTTP. Мне все еще нужны сертификаты для настройки пользовательских доменных имен или будет работать частный IP-адрес управления API?
После выполнения запроса GET на внешний IP-адрес шлюза выдает ошибку 5 ** .
Помогите пожалуйста.